2 pickleball courts in Seffner, Florida

Image of North Brandon Family YMCA

North Brandon Family YMCA

3097 S. Kingsway Rd., Seffner, FL 33584, USA

2 indoor courts

Higginbotham Park

1104 N Kingsway Rd, Seffner, FL 33584, United States

8 outdoor courts

Loading map...